Everspin Technologies is a public semiconductor company that develops and manufactures magnetic RAM or Magnetoresistive Random Access Memory (MRAM), including stand-alone and embedded MRAM products as well as Spin-torque MRAM (ST-MRAM). MRAM has the performance characteristics similar to standard Random Access Memory (RAM) while also having the persistence of non-volatile memory, meaning that it will not lose its charge or data if power is removed from the system. This characteristic makes MRAM suitable for a large number of embedded applications, such as automotive and industrial where both performance and permanence are required.

The company was formed in June 2008 as a spin out of Freescale Semiconductor. In 2014 Everspin partnered with GLOBALFOUNDRIES for production of in-plane and perpendicular MTJ ST-MRAM on 300mm wafers, utilizing 40nm and 28nm node processes.  Everspin went public with an IPO in October 2016.

The path to MRAM began in 1984 when the GMR Effect discovered by IBM. Twelve years later, in 1996, Spin Torque Transfer is proposed, enabling a magnetic tunnel junction or spin valve to be modified with a spin-polarized current. At this point, Motorola began their MRAM research, which led to their first MTJ in 1998. A year later, in 1999, Motorola developed a 256Kb MRAM Test Chip that enabled work to begin on productizing MRAM technology, which was followed by a patent for Toggle being granted to Motorola in 2002. Much of the early MRAM work was done by Motorola, who spun off their semiconductor business in 2004, creating Freescale Semiconductor, which eventually spun out the MRAM business as Everspin Technologies.
